About VEC
The Virtual Engineering Centre (VEC) is a leading digital impact centre established in 2010 by the University of Liverpool, supported by EU funding and in partnership with BAE Systems and National Nuclear Laboratory. We work cross-sector with our clients to address and solve their business challenges, including areas such as digital design and engineering. We support their innovation journey by deploying emerging research and intelligent digital technologies to improve and advance their business capabilities. Pioneers in industrial digital transformation through the adoption of advanced technologies and toolsets, we help businesses large and small to foster collaboration, support productivity and sustainable business growth. As part of the University of Liverpool and through key partnerships, we have access to the very latest scientific infrastructure and thought leadership bridging the innovation gap between academic research and new product development within SMEs and large corporations. Harnessing the latest technologies within our digital laboratories, clients can explore and gain a deep understanding of their data to make better informed business decisions leading to improved long-term social and industry impact. The VEC’s core capabilities: • We create integrated collaborative digital frameworks to support the development of complex systems and enable efficiency and connectivity across supply chains. • We help organisations understand their data and use those insights and predictions to deliver value. • We create bespoke digital test beds and use advanced modelling, simulation and immersive visualisation to de-risk and improve products and processes. • We help organisations of all sizes to explore, assess and adopt digital technologies, supported by the appropriate skills development.
